Yesterday's Enemy

British war drama set in 1942. Captain Langford (Stanley Baker) and his group of soldiers travel through a Burmese jungle as they are tracked by the Japanese army.

When Langford's unit discovers a village commanded by the Japanese, they destroy the enemy, but Langford soon finds out that the now deceased Japanese military leader had a secret coded map.

To get the map decoded the Captain goes to extreme measures - he kills two villagers to convince a prisoner to pass on information.

However, Langford's brutality is nothing compared to that of the enemy.
